Original Post:

"1969 Gottlieb's "Wild Wild West" Super cute two player pinball machine western themed pinball machine from Gottlieb. Maintained and fully functional Posts, Rubber, Lamps. Original - Flippers, Pop bumpers, Shooter, Coin entries, Coin door, Side rails, Legs, Locks and Hardware.

Wild Wild West is ready for a long happy life in your game room. Authentic and original cabinet paint and chrome, this is a sharp, clean vintage pinball machine. The stainless steel side rails and legs add a bit of industrial feel.

Excellent cosmetic condition for a 45 year old pinball machine. Wild Wild West along with other great Gottlieb western pinball machines blended pinball with the wild west. Only 150 were made so there can't be more than a handful left in the world in this very nice condition.

These All American made in Chicago vintage pinball machines are quality. The finest craftsmanship and materials were used in making these classic pinball machines. I have the original wiring diagrams too! and a few spare lights and rings.

This game has all the bells (no whistles!) Sounds like the classic old arcade and lots of fun for kids and adults. When I got this from my parents they had built a small wood step for me to use so I could see over the top - well that was a long time ago. This has been in my family for over 40 years.

Fun game play on one of Gottlieb's cutest pinball machines:
 Varitargets harder you hit them the higher the score value
 Varitargets to the top lights the "Wow" to win extra balls
 Two kickout holes score the targets value
 Replays for high scores and end of game match
 Win free games and the population of Dry Gulch goes up ("Rabbits!" see pictures below)
